The third road game was the charm for Georgia Military College, as they earned their first away win of the season. They walked away with a 28-18 victory over the Twiggs County Cobras on Friday. This was payback for the Bulldogs, who suffered a 24-17 loss the last time these two teams met.

Evan Stasney was nothing short of spectacular: he rushed for 133 yards and two touchdowns.

They were just one part of a punishing run game: Georgia Military College was unstoppable on the ground and finished the game with 235 rushing yards. That's the most rushing yards they've managed all season.

Georgia Military College didn't go easy on the quarterback and picked off four passes before the game was over. Walt Greene led the group effort, picking up two of those interceptions all by himself.

Georgia Military College picked up their first road win, bumping their record up to 2-4. As for Twiggs County, their defeat dropped their record down to 0-6.

Georgia Military College has already played their next contest, a 36-18 victory against Glascock County on the 3rd. As for Twiggs County, they also wasted no time getting back out on the field and have already played their next matchup, a 42-0 loss against Johnson County on the 3rd.
